Communication Barriers

Autism can lead to unique communication styles or challenges in social settings.

Illustration for Communication Barriers
Children with autism might not make eye contact when speaking.
LampPro Tip 2/3

Behavioral Patterns

Autism might involve repetitive behaviors or intense interests in specific subjects.

Illustration for Behavioral Patterns
He has autism and likes to line up his toys in a specific order.
LampPro Tip 3/3

Spectrum Variance

Autism is a spectrum, meaning symptoms can range from mild to severe.

Illustration for Spectrum Variance
She has a mild form of autism but still excels in school.
